## Trust breakdown

How this component scores in each security and reliability category. Every signal is checked automatically against the live server, and we only credit what we can confirm. Scores are 0–100 per category. Scoring method: https://verifymcp.io/docs/scoring (what has changed: https://verifymcp.io/docs/scoring/changelog)

Scored 2026-08-03.

- **Endpoint Security**: 80/100
  - The endpoint's TLS certificate is valid, in date, and uses a strong key.
  - No authorisation is required to call this server. Every tool declares its destructiveHint and none is destructive, so open access doesn't expose one.
  - HTTPS is enforced; there's no plaintext access path.
  - The HSTS (Strict-Transport-Security) header is present.
  - DNSSEC check failed: this domain isn't protected by DNSSEC.
- **Transport & Reachability**: 100/100
  - Verified streamable-http transport via a live MCP handshake.
- **Schema Quality & AI Usability**: 46/100
  - AI-judged instruction clarity (poor).
  - Tool/resource definitions use about 420 tokens (~105/item across 4 items; 4 tools + 0 resources), lean.
  - Usage-examples check failed: none of the tools include examples.
- **Stability & Change Management**: 27/100
  - Stability observed for 8 of 30 days with no destabilising changes; credit accrues until the full window elapses.
- **Tool Coverage**: 76/100
  - 100% of tools have a non-trivial description (not blank, and not just the tool's name).
  - 29% of tool parameters carry a description.
- **Capabilities**: 100/100
  - Implements a supported MCP spec version (2025-11-25); the latest is 2026-07-28.

## MCP tools (4)

### `list_drives` (~73 tokens)

List published Roamward drives

United States coverage across 50 published drives today; strongest in the West and Southwest, with coverage growing in waves. Lists published, shelf-reviewed drives at zero Mapbox cost. For individual-assistant use with attribution. Bulk extraction, redistribution, or commercial dataset use requires a license — contact hello@roamward.app.

### `get_drive` (~94 tokens)

Get one published Roamward drive

United States coverage across 50 published drives today; strongest in the West and Southwest, with coverage growing in waves. Returns the frozen corridor, ranked detour shelf, adjacent drives, and plan URL at zero Mapbox cost. For individual-assistant use with attribution. Bulk extraction, redistribution, or commercial dataset use requires a license — contact hello@roamward.app.

Input parameters:

- `slug` (string, required): Published /drives slug.

### `search_stops` (~104 tokens)

Search Roamward stops

United States coverage across 50 published drives today; strongest in the West and Southwest, with coverage growing in waves. Uses the same exact-first, category-aware scorer as roamward.app search and returns at most 10 stops. For individual-assistant use with attribution. Bulk extraction, redistribution, or commercial dataset use requires a license — contact hello@roamward.app.

Input parameters:

- `query` (string, required)
- `state` (string): Optional USPS code or full state name.

### `plan_drive` (~119 tokens)

Plan a detour-aware U.S. drive

United States coverage across 50 published drives today; strongest in the West and Southwest, with coverage growing in waves. Published endpoint pairs use their stored shelf with zero Mapbox calls; novel pairs use one capped live route or honestly degrade to published alternatives. For individual-assistant use with attribution. Bulk extraction, redistribution, or commercial dataset use requires a license — contact hello@roamward.app.

Input parameters:

- `detourBudgetMinutes` (number)
- `from` (string, required)
- `hideKinds` (array)
- `to` (string, required)
